WORKSサルの経験値

飲食店予約・注文アプリ開発

Webシステム サーバー構築
2ヶ月 5人体制 PL・SE・PG
言語 / Framework
HTML CSS Typescript PHP Laravel Nuxt.js
環境
Linux AWS MySQL Docker
ツール
GitHub Visual Studio Code PHPStorm Slack
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

飲食店向けの予約情報の登録、商品の注文を行なうアプリの開発。

業務詳細
  • フロントエンドの実装を担当。
  • バックエンドの実装を担当。
  • 単体テストの実施。

デジタルサイネージ配信システム開発

Webシステム サーバー構築
1年2ヶ月 5人体制 PL・SE・PG
言語 / Framework
HTMLJavaScriptPHPNuxt.jsLaravel
環境
LinuxAWSDockerMySQL
ツール
PHPStormGitHubSlack
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

Android端末を用いたデジタルサイネージ配信システムの開発。
本部から各エリア/店舗にコンテンツを配信できる管理機能を構築。
「要件定義」からインフラ(AWS)の構成、プログラム実装、試験までを一気通貫で当社で行いました。
Android端末(デジタルサイネージ)は他社が「Electron」で作成しましたが、サイネージの描画部分「スライドショーなどの表示」と通信部分(API)」は当社で担当しました。

業務詳細
  • Laravelによるバックエンド開発を担当
  • Nuxt.jsによるフロントエンド開発を担当
  • 単体テストの実施
  • テストコードの作成

IP電話システム保守

Webシステム
1年3ヶ月 10人体制
言語 / Framework
SIP Asterisk
環境
Linux AWS
ツール
WireShark Visual Studio Code
開発工程
総合テスト 保守
案件概要
概要

SIP電話交換システムの保守

業務詳細
  • 総合テストの実施
  • SIPプロトコル解析と障害分析

動画配信システム開発・保守

Webシステム
5人体制 SE・PG
言語 / Framework
Python Django Javascript C++
環境
Linux AWS
ツール
Visual Studio Code Gitea Subversion Hyper-V HLS Celery RabbitMQ Redis ffmpeg
開発工程
詳細設計 デバッグ 保守
案件概要
概要

動画配信システムの改良、配信最適化・運用保守

業務詳細
  • データ量増大での処理破綻問題を、アルゴリズム改良・処理最適化で解消
  • 各種不具合調査と修正
  • OSアップデート対応
  • AWSコスト削減提案

アキパス

Androidアプリ iOSアプリ Webシステム
3人体制 PL・SE・PG
言語 / Framework
SQL PHP CakePHP Java(Android) Objective-C Swift
環境
Linux MySQL AWS Docker
ツール
PHPStorm Xcode Android Studio GitHub Redmine
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

秋葉原のご当地アプリで、Beaconを使ったチェックインをしてクーポンを貰ったりキャラを育てたりするアプリになります。※現在も改修は続けております。

案件詳細
  • サービス設計から仕様作成、iOSアプリの作成、Androidアプリの作成、バックエンドの作成など一通りの作業を当社で実施

各種測定器(センサー端末)とホスティングサービスの開発

Webシステム
7ヶ月 3人体制 PG
言語 / Framework
HTML CSS JavaScript Java(Servlet/JSP)
環境
MySQL
ツール
Tomcat SVN
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

工事現場などに設置された騒音/振動/温度センサーなどの各種センサーのデータを収集し、中央サーバーで管理するWEBアプリになります。スマート農業分野や歩行や血圧などの健康状態管理アプリと連携することもできます。サーバーはtomcat(JAVA)で起動するWEBサーバーを主に扱いましたが、C言語で作成されたSocket通信サーバー(センサーへの設定用サーバー)も改修いたしました。

業務詳細
  • Javaのバックエンドの修正を担当。
  • 単体テストの実施。

AIチャットボットシステム開発

Webシステム
9ヶ月 5人体制 PL・SE・PG
言語 / Framework
JavaScript PHP Laravel
環境
Linux AWS Docker MySQL
ツール
PHPStorm GitHub Slack Backlog Chatwork
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

類似文書エンジンを用いたチャットボットのサービスプラットフォームの開発。

業務詳細
  • フロントエンド実装を担当
  • バックエンド実装を担当
  • PM離脱後にプロジェクト管理も兼任
  • 単体テストの実施

イラスト投稿サイト開発

Webシステム
3年 4人体制 SE・PG
言語 / Framework
HTML CSS TypeScript PHP Laravel Vue.js
環境
Linux MySQL GCP Docker
ツール
PHPStorm GitHub Slack
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

ユーザーがイラストを投稿し、公開・非公開・ダウンロードを管理できるWebサービス。
要件定義から運用保守まで幅広く担当。

業務詳細
  • TypeScript を Vue.js プロジェクトへ初導入
  • フロントエンド実装を担当
  • バックエンド実装を担当
  • 単体テストおよび結合テストの実施

オンプレミスサーバーのクラウド移行

AWS
3.5ヶ月 3人体制 PG
言語 / Framework
環境
Linux
ツール
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

オンプレミス環境のサーバーを AWS 環境に移行するプロジェクト。

環境データ管理システム開発

Webシステム
2ヶ月 2人体制 PG
言語 / Framework
Ruby Ruby on rails SQL
環境
Linux Docker
ツール
Github VisulaStudioCode
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

電力消費量・CO₂排出量等の環境データを取得し、計算処理を行うシステム。

業務詳細
  • バックエンドの Ruby 実装を担当
  • 環境データ計算処理ロジックの実装
  • 単体テスト・結合テストの実施

電力トレーサビリティシステム開発

Webシステム
3ヶ月 2人体制 PG
言語 / Framework
JavaScript PHP Laravel Vue.js
環境
Linux
ツール
Github PHPStorm
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

施設の電力消費量・発電量のデータを取得し、集計・グラフ化するシステム。

業務詳細
  • PHP(Laravel)でのバックエンド実装を担当
  • Vue.js によるフロントエンド実装
  • 集計処理・グラフ表示ロジックの実装
  • 単体テスト・結合テストの実施

物件調査・施工管理サイト開発

Webシステム
4ヶ月 3人体制 PG
言語 / Framework
PHP Laravel TypeScript Nuxt.js
環境
Linux Docker MySQL Spring
ツール
PHPStorm Github SpringToolSuite VisualStudioCode
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

物件調査、施工管理を行なうシステム。

業務詳細
  • フロントエンドの実装。
  • バックエンドの実装。
  • 単体テストおよび結合テストの実施。

BIツール開発

Webシステム
1ヶ月 3人体制 PG
言語 / Framework
PHP Laravel
環境
Windows GoogleDrive
ツール
PHPStorm Github PowerAutomeate LookerStudio
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

各種アプリ・システムから自動でデータを取得し、クラウドデータベースに登録し、グラフ化する BI システム。

業務詳細
  • バックエンドの実装。
  • 自動データ取得処理の開発。
  • Looker Studio を用いた可視化設定。
  • 単体テストおよび結合テストの実施。

飲食向け需給表の開発

Webシステム
2人体制 PG
言語 / Framework
GAS
環境
Googleスプレッドシート GoogleDrive
ツール
GAS
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

飲食店の材料を管理する需給表を各サプライヤーと連携し、管理者用とサプライヤー用で表の出し分けを行う運用の開発。

業務詳細
  • GAS を用いたスプレッドシート自動計算ロジックの開発。

動画配信プラットフォーム開発

Webシステム
5人体制 PM・SE・PG
言語 / Framework
Laravel
環境
AWS
ツール
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

Webシステムの動画配信プラットフォーム開発。

業務詳細
  • PM・SE・PG として全体工程に参加。
  • 動画配信向けの機能要件整理。
  • バックエンドの実装および仕様調整。

学習コンテンツ発信サービス開発

Webシステム
5人体制 PM・SE・PG
言語 / Framework
Nuxt.js Laravel
環境
AWS
ツール
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

学習コンテンツの配信サービス開発。

業務詳細
  • フロント(Nuxt.js)とバックエンド(Laravel)の開発を担当。
  • PM として進行管理および要件整理を兼任。
  • AWS 上で運用するための環境整備。

資産継承アプリ開発

iOSアプリ
2ヶ月 3人体制 SE・PG
言語 / Framework
SwiftUI
環境
iOS
ツール
GitHubXCode
開発工程
要件定義基本設計詳細設計製造 単体テスト結合テスト運用保守
案件概要
概要

資産の継承を行なうアプリの開発。

業務詳細
  • iPadアプリとしてSwiftUIで実装。
  • 「Multipeer Connectivityフレームワーク」を利用して、iPad端末同士への暗号化のデータ送信
  • 単体テストの実施。

IoT起動によるビデオ通話システム試作

Androidアプリ
2ヶ月 2人体制 PL・SE・PG
言語 / Framework
Java JavaScript WebRTC
環境
AndroidOS
ツール
Android Studio MESH GitLab
開発工程
要件定義基本設計詳細設計製造 単体テスト結合テスト運用保守
案件概要
概要

IoTデバイスMESHからのアクションでAndroid端末同士でビデオ通話をするシステムの試作

業務詳細
  • WebRTCサービスをJavaScriptから呼び出し、WebViewで表示する方式により最小工数で原理確認ソフトを試作
  • 結合テストまでを実施

アキパス

Androidアプリ iOSアプリ Webシステム
3人体制 PL・SE・PG
言語 / Framework
SQL PHP CakePHP Java(Android) Objective-C Swift
環境
Linux MySQL AWS Docker
ツール
PHPStorm Xcode Android Studio GitHub Redmine
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

秋葉原のご当地アプリで、Beaconを使ったチェックインをしてクーポンを貰ったりキャラを育てたりするアプリになります。※現在も改修は続けております。

案件詳細
  • サービス設計から仕様作成、iOSアプリの作成、Androidアプリの作成、バックエンドの作成など一通りの作業を当社で実施

ヘルスケアiOSアプリ開発

iOSアプリ
2ヶ月 3人体制 SE・PG
言語 / Framework
Swift SwiftUI
環境
iOS
ツール
Xcode GitHub Slack Redmine
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

HUAWEI Band 8からヘルスケアデータをBluetoothで取得して、iOSアプリにヘルスケア状態を表示し、サーバー上に健康状態を送信するアプリになります。

業務詳細
  • Bluetoothの通信部分をメインで担当。
  • 単体テストの実施。

医療系Webサービス開発(iOSアプリ担当)

iOSアプリ
5ヶ月 2人体制 PG
言語 / Framework
Swift SwiftUI
環境
iOS
ツール
Xcode GitHub
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

医療系に特化したWEB予約サービス。
iPadカメラによる診察券(QRコード)読み取り機能を担当。

業務詳細
  • iOSフロントエンド部分の実装を担当
  • QRコード読み取り処理の実装
  • 単体テストの実施

歯科病院向け予約システム

iOSアプリ
3ヶ月 2人体制 PG
言語 / Framework
Swift SQL Ruby Ruby on Rails
環境
WindowsServer SQLServer
ツール
GitHub Xcode Slack Swagger
開発工程
要件定義 基本設計 詳細設計 製造 単体テスト 結合テスト 運用保守
案件概要
概要

歯科病院向けの予約システム(iPadアプリ)。
医療事務用アプリとして利用され、バックエンドは Windows Server 上で稼働。
省力化のため Swagger で API コードを自動生成。

業務詳細
  • iPadアプリ向け Swift 実装を担当
  • フロントエンド中心に実装しつつ、バックエンド改修も実施
  • 単体テスト・結合テストの実施

Web会議システム開発

WindowsアプリiOSアプリ AndroidアプリWebシステム
8人体制 SE・PG
言語 / Framework
C++X86 IntrinsicsObjective-C JavaPythonJavascriptTypescript DjangoMFC
環境
WindowsiOSMacOS AndroidOSLinux
ツール
GitLabVisual StudioVisual Studio Code XCodeAndroid StudioHyper-V VP8IPPOpenCVlibyuv PDFiumWireShark
開発工程
要件定義基本設計詳細設計製造 単体テスト結合テスト運用保守
案件概要
概要

Web会議システムの開発・運用保守。

業務詳細
  • 画像処理・データ圧縮アルゴリズムの開発と実装
  • Windows版ビデオドライバおよびプリンタドライバの開発
  • PDFビューワーの作成
  • H323プロトコルコンバーターの設計と実装
  • 単体・総合テストの計画と実施
  • 各種OSアップデート対応
  • 障害分析と対策提案

RFID物流システムの開発

Windowsアプリ
2ヶ月 2人体制 PG
言語 / Framework
C# .Net Framework
環境
Windows SQLServer
ツール
VisualStudio Slack
開発工程
要件定義基本設計詳細設計製造 単体テスト結合テスト運用保守
案件概要
概要

アパレル業者の商品入出庫をRFID機器を使用して管理するシステム。